Written Answers. - County Donegal Military Installations.

Dinny McGinley

Ceist:

127 Mr. McGinley asked the Minister for Defence if he will outline (1) the location and numerical strength of each military installation in County Donegal (2) the location with helicopter and landing facilities and (3) whether there are plans to further develop any of the installations.

The military installations in County Donegal comprise Finner Camp, Lifford military post and Rockhill House, Letterkenny. In addition, there are a number of permanent Border checkpoints. It is not the practice to disclose the numerical strength of military installations.

A helicopter is based at Finner Camp and landing facilities for helicopters are available at the other two principal installations in County Donegal.

Works are in progress in Finner Camp to improve the facilities there for helicopter operations for air sea rescue purposes. Certain improvement works have been carried out in Lifford and Rockhill during 1991.
